Thursday Night Excitement

At 9:30, I was watching a DVR'd 'So you think you can dance!'... and I heard this noise. I thought it was Marcos trying to get my attention and I said "Marcos?"... he said "Yeah?"... I asked him if he heard that. He did, and said it was outside. We both ran to the door - I thought someone was breaking into our garage. We rushed to get shoes on - and when we got to our driveway... this is what we saw:


(as always - click to make bigger)


Well, to be percise - this picture was taken after the Fire Truck, EMTs and teen aged drunk driver left the scene. Yes, I did say teen aged and drunk. And yes, that's just feet from my driveway. My mailbox is just down the way - I walk down that sidewalk every day.
We live on a main neighborhood street - the speed limit is 30 - the average speed driven is 50.
There is a school just north of us (in the pic, the car is just north of my truck)... There are a TON of kids - yet people still drive like idiots.

So - there were NO skid marks, and we did not hear any tire squealing... they say he rolled 5 or 6 times into the curve of the road. He barely missed a car, a tree and the light pole in our yard. He got out of the car and was walking around, talking on his cell phone.

We got him a chair to sit in - and just waited for the police. By the time the police arrived, the whole neighborhood was out (never saw half of them before in my life!). Even the cop asked me I was sick of the speeders. I certainly am. They could have easily flown into Alex and Nic's room (which is the front room of the house)...




And the view from the other side. We had no idea how bad it was - I mean, we knew it rolled - but look at the damage. The door? Gone. It's about 2 houses north of where the car stopped.




There was so much junk in the car, we had some land in our drive way. Thankfully, our cars and yard were undamaged.

Isa was awake - but Alex and Nic were asleep. I woke up Alex so that he could see the lesson in this... this is what happens to kids who drink and drive.

I am sorry that the guy was hurt, I am sorry about the accident - but at the same time I am BOILING mad that he risked so many lives. People walk down our street all the time. His car landed in the Bike Lane.

It took two hours - but the mess if finally cleared up. I will check it out tomorrow to see the damage to my neighbors yard.

Update on our 18 mo old. (6/7/08)

Alright – update on Nic.


He had his developmental evaluation last week – and passed – so we will not be doing any type of therapy. The nice lady said that “Quack” was a word! Lol… And since then, he does a much better job of saying Isa (should be eee-saa, he says eats-uh) and he says something like “cogs” for the dogs. I am not too worried – and neither was she. Nic does a lot of pointing, bringing me to things, giving me things – she says that he is above average (based on his adjusted age of 15 months) for Gross Motor Skills. So, I am pleased as punch. At his doctor’s appointment on Thursday afternoon – Nic weighed in at 26lbs even, and is 33” tall (and his head is 47cm). He is in the 50th percentile for full term 18 month olds – the doc said she has been kinda shocked about him. She said no one could ever tell he was born so premature. This kid has me on guard 24/7.
